The nature of CO2 exchange in the stem of pine (Pinus sylvestris L.) was analyzed on the basis of experimental data and evidence in the literature. The following basic questions were examined here: source of carbon dioxide in the stem: influence of the main physical factors on solubility and concentration of separate chemical forms of carbon dioxide in stem tissues; characteristics of CO2 diffusion in stem tissues of different anatomical structure; and criteria that in certain measure make it possible to interpret CO2 exchange of the stem as its respiration. All of this enabled us to conclude that carbon dioxide exchange of the pine stem in regard to its nature primarily reflects its respiration.
